Feed mechanism of water paint processing
Technical Field
The utility model relates to a paint vehicle processing technology field, concretely relates to feed mechanism of water based paint processing.
Background
Along with the pressure of environmental protection policy, the environmental protection consciousness of consumers is continuously improved, and particularly, the VOC emission limit standard is set out in provinces and cities all over the country, so that the development of environment-friendly coatings such as non-solvent type coatings, water-based paints and the like is encouraged to bring opportunities. Although the traditional coating still occupies a large market share, the water-based paint is a green industry and is the direction of future development of paints, and domestic native water-based paint faucet enterprises are rising.
At the in-process of personnel to paint mixing of colors, need add according to the paint vehicle addition volume and mix the stirring back and use in the paint kettle, but at stirring in-process personnel need with its other paint compounding that adds to it brings unnecessary trouble to give personnel, the phenomenon that can appear paint spill simultaneously at the stirring in-process, thereby brings unnecessary work trouble to give personnel.
Therefore, a device which can be used for achieving certain convenience in the paint color mixing process and avoiding paint splashing in the paint stirring process is needed.

Example one
As shown in FIG. 1: a feeding mechanism for processing water paint comprises a filling mechanism 1, a stirring mechanism 2, a placing table 3 and a paint bucket 4, wherein a groove 5 is formed in the upper end of the placing table 3, a rubber pad 6 is arranged along the inner circumference of the groove 5, the bottom of the paint bucket 4 is matched with the inner part of the groove 5, a supporting shaft 7 is arranged on one side of the end part of the placing table 3, the lower end of the supporting shaft 7 is rotatably connected with the end part of the placing table 3, a fixing support 8 is arranged on the supporting shaft 7, a hydraulic telescopic rod 9 is arranged in the fixing support 8, a supporting frame 10 is fixedly arranged at the upper end of the fixing support 8, one extending end of the hydraulic telescopic rod 9 is fixedly connected with the supporting frame 10, the filling mechanism 1 comprises a feeding bin 11 arranged on one side of the supporting frame 10, a communicating pipe 12 is arranged at the lower end of the feeding bin 11, a control valve 13 is arranged at the joint of the feeding bin 11 and the communicating pipe 12, the feeding bin 11 is arranged corresponding to the groove 5, a sealing cover 14 is arranged at the lower end of the supporting frame 10 corresponding to the lower end of the feeding bin 11, and the sealing cover 14 is matched with the opening of the paint bucket 4.
Specifically, the paint bucket can be stably fixed in the groove through the groove arranged on the end part of the placing platform, the rubber pad arranged in the groove is matched and connected with the lower end of the paint bucket, the supporting shaft is arranged on one side of the placing platform and is rotationally connected with the end part of the placing platform, so that the fixed support arranged on the supporting shaft rotates along with the rotation of the supporting shaft, the end part of the support frame extending out of a hydraulic telescopic rod arranged in the fixed support is fixedly connected with the supporting frame through the supporting frame arranged at the upper end of the fixed support, so that the supporting frame can be adjusted up and down, the feeding bin arranged on the end part of one side of the supporting frame, and the communicating pipe arranged at the lower end of the feeding bin, so that the mixed paint is added to have certain convenience, and the control performance of a person for adding the mixed paint is facilitated through the control valve arranged at the joint of the feeding bin and the communicating pipe, the sealing cover that the setting is being added the feed bin and is setting up at the support frame lower extreme to the messenger mixes the stirring in-process at the paint and has certain leakproofness, thereby avoids the phenomenon of paint spill, has improved the convenience of personnel's work greatly.
According to an embodiment of the present invention, as shown in fig. 1;
the stirring mechanism 2 comprises a driving motor 15 arranged at the other end of the support frame 10, a driving shaft 16 is arranged on the driving motor 15, one end of the driving shaft 16 is arranged at the inner end of the support frame 10, a driving wheel 17 is arranged on the driving shaft 16, a fixed block 18 is arranged on one side in the support frame 10, a rotating shaft 19 is arranged on the fixed block 18 in a penetrating mode and corresponds to the driving wheel 17, a driven wheel 20 is arranged on the rotating shaft 19 through the driving wheel 17, the driving wheel 17 is connected with the driven wheel 20 through transmission of a transmission belt, one end of the rotating shaft 19 is arranged at the lower end of the support frame 10 and penetrates through the central part of the sealing cover 14, and a stirring sheet 21 is arranged at the end part of the rotating shaft 19 at the lower end of the support frame 10. Through setting up the driving motor in the support frame upper end, driving motor's the epaxial action wheel of drive shaft passes through chain drive, makes the setting run through fixed piece tip rotation epaxial from the driving wheel rotation in the support frame to make the rotation axis rotate under driving motor's the effect, through setting up the stirring piece on the rotation axis tip, thereby make the abundant dissolution of mixed paint together, thereby improved the convenience of personnel's work.
According to an embodiment of the present invention, as shown in fig. 1;
add feed bin 11 and make by transparent material, set up the scale on adding feed bin tip. Through the scale on the end part of the feeding bin, a person can conveniently add the mixed paint with an accurate amount, and the mixed paint can reach a certain color change.
According to an embodiment of the present invention, as shown in fig. 1;
correspond control storehouse 22 is set up in fixed bolster 8 to hydraulic telescoping rod 9 tip, set up switch 23, controller 24 in the control storehouse 22, set up key switch 25 on the control storehouse 22 lateral wall, key switch 25 connection director 24, driving motor 15, hydraulic telescoping rod 9 are connected to controller 24. Through setting up controller and switch in the control storehouse to the use of the personnel of being convenient for control hydraulic telescoping rod and driving motor, and then the convenience when personnel stir the mixed paint has been improved.
The utility model discloses a use method:
raise the support frame through hydraulic telescoping rod, thereby be convenient for personnel put into the recess with the paint kettle, through the rotation of the driving motor drive rotation axis of setting on the support frame, thereby make the stirring piece on the rotating shaft tip stir, through setting up the reinforced storehouse in the support frame upper end, the communicating pipe that sets up on the reinforced storehouse, and the control valve that sets up on the communicating pipe, in the entering paint kettle of the mixed paint of being convenient for, improve the convenience when personnel will paint the mixing stirring greatly, the homogeneity that the mixed paint discolours has been improved greatly.
